dc.description.abstract | The purpose of my project is to create a fully operational weather application that can gather and display weather data from the majority of locations worldwide. I have decided to build a web-based weather application utilizing a weather API (Application Programming Interface) to access and present accurate, up-to-date weather data to users. I was inspired to develop this application because I wanted to offer users a dependable and user-friendly tool for accessing weather information, which can help them make better decisions in their daily lives based on real-time weather conditions. I chose this project because I recognize the significant impact weather has on people's lives, and I wanted to address the increasing demand for precise, real-time weather information. Additionally, I was excited to explore and implement modern web development technologies. The project will test my ability to integrate a suitable weather API, create a visually appealing and user-friendly interface, and ensure the overall functionality of the application. I will be developing the weather application using well-known programming languages like JavaScript, HTML, and CSS. I will carefully select a weather API based on factors such as the type of weather data offered, update frequency, data accuracy, and the presence of necessary features. The user interface will be designed with simplicity, ease of use, and visual appeal in mind, concentrating on presenting weather information in a clear and straightforward way. A successful outcome for this project will be an application that reliably retrieves and displays accurate weather data from most locations on Earth, provides an enjoyable user experience, and is compatible with a wide range of devices and operating systems. To achieve this, I will thoroughly test the application in various weather conditions and locations, and ensure compatibility with multiple devices and operating systems. Through this project, I aim to offer a comprehensive guide on creating a weather application that meets users' needs and demonstrates the latest web development techniques and best practices. | |
